Features at a Glance

Key components: Large capacity drum, multiple drying programs, energy-efficient operation, and a user-friendly interface.

FeatureDescription
Condenser TechnologyEfficient drying without the need for external venting
Multiple Drying ProgramsVarious settings for different fabric types
Large CapacityCan handle up to 8 kg of laundry
Energy EfficiencyClass A rating for energy consumption
Anti-Crease FunctionReduces wrinkles in clothes
Child LockPrevents accidental operation by children

Maintenance and Care

Reg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ance.

  1. Clean the lint filter after every use.
  2. Check and clean the condenser unit periodically.
  3. Inspect the power cord and plug for damage.

CAUTION! Unplug the dryer before performing any maintenance.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er does not startNo powerCheck power supply and connections.
No heatIncorrect settingsEnsure the correct drying program is selected.
Long drying timesBlocked lint filterClean the lint filter and condenser.
Unusual noisesForeign objectsCheck drum for any items that may be causing noise.
